Song Details
Duration: 2:40 (M_Robertcop) 
Release Date: 9/11/2001  (M_Robertcop) 
Lyrics By: Rodgers Grant, Pat Patrick, Jon Hendricks (M_Robertcop) 
Music By: Rodgers Grant, Pat Patrick, Jon Hendricks (M_Robertcop) 
Produced By:
Released By: Restless Records (M_Robertcop) 
Published By: Mongo Music, Second Floor Music, Solange Songs (M_Robertcop) 
Licensing: ASCAP  #550054029 (M_Robertcop) 
Keywords:
Reviews:
Facts:
  • Also licensed under BMI #1702580 (M_Robertcop)
  • Cover of "Yeh Yeh" originally by Mongo Santamaría (M_Robertcop)
